SleepyJim Posted May 16, 2018 Posted May 16, 2018 Ah, I searched for "Frostmer."  I can't see anything in the description or comments that says what body type it uses. Basically, if a custom race has its own body meshes then it likely won't match whichever body you have installed for everyone else. In that case a custom race female PC will have a different body shape to every other female character in the game. When you build outfits in bodyslide (like you need to do for devious devices) you'll probably be building them to fit the general body you have installed, which means the outfits will fit NPCs but not the PC. The easiest way to have them fit everyone is to examine the folder structure of the race mod, find where it has its body, hands and feet meshes, and replace them with the ones you use for everyone else.  The vanilla location for the body meshes is Data\meshes\actors\character\character assets. In that folder CBBE will have installed the following:  femalebody_0.nif femalebody_1.nif femalefeet_0.nif femalefeet_1.nif femalehands_0.nif femalehands_1.nif  If you can find where the race mod has files of those names you can copy and paste the CBBE ones in to replace them. That might be enough to work, although it looks as though the race has wings, which might complicate things. And as I said, the race's body textures might not be compatible with CBBE. The only thing to do is try and see how it looks.

SleepyJim Posted May 17, 2018 Posted May 17, 2018 You can peek inside a bsa, or extract it, using something like BAE. (That's on the SE Nexus, but works perfectly for classic Skyrim as well.) With that tool installed you can double click any bsa and have a look at what's inside it. You can then choose if and where to extract it, and which parts to extract. At the very least it will allow you to see if the race does indeed include its own body, hands and feet meshes, and where they are. You could then create a loose folder structure of your own to drop in replacements that would overwrite the originals without touching the bsa itself.
